three. pH Neutral and Nutrient Availability: Coco coir has a neutral pH, which implies it doesn't significantly alter the acidity or alkalinity of the rising surroundings. This neutrality supplies a steady pH degree for plants, permitting them to entry and take in nutrients effectively. Coco coir additionally has a excessive cation change capacity, facilitating the provision of essential minerals to plants.

1. Potting Mixes: Coconut fiber substrate is usually used as a element in potting mixes. Its excellent water retention capabilities assist ensure constant moisture ranges for plant roots. It also promotes correct aeration and drainage, stopping waterlogging and root rot. Incorporating coconut fiber substrate into potting mixes improves the overall texture and construction of the growing medium, offering an optimum setting for plant progress.

1. Nutrient Availability: Coco coir is comparatively inert and does not comprise significant nutrients by itself. Therefore, you will want to provide appropriate fertilizers or nutrient solutions to fulfill the nutritional requirements of your plants.

5. Orchid Growing: Coconut fiber substrate is a popular selection for growing orchids. It supplies the mandatory moisture retention while allowing adequate airflow across the orchid roots. The fibrous texture also mimics the natural habitat of many orchids, promoting healthy root progress. Coconut fiber substrate can be utilized as a standalone medium or blended with other supplies like bark or perlite for particular orchid species.
